Frequent Wildlife Challenges in Urban Environments

Urban settings regularly face a multitude of animal-related issues that can affect daily life and present health risks. Rodent pests, such as rats and mice, frequently invade homes and businesses, pursuing food and shelter. Their presence can cause property damage and the spread of illnesses like hantavirus and leptospirosis. In a similar manner, raccoons and squirrels regularly take advantage of urban environments, foraging in trash and settling in attics, which can result in further sanitation issues.

Pigeons and birds, can prove problematic, bringing about ugly droppings that endanger public health and deteriorate buildings. In turn, substantial creatures like deer may advance into metropolitan zones, causing unsafe encounters on roads. As wildlife settles into urban life, the disputes among people and wildlife intensify, calling for sound management approaches to handle these challenges and preserve community safety.

Health Problems Abatement

When animals invade residential areas, they can create substantial hazards to safety, making wildlife removal vital for maintaining well-being. Untamed fauna frequently transmit illnesses that can transfer to people, including rabies, hantavirus, and leptospirosis. Their waste matter and urine can contaminate areas and air, creating respiratory issues or infections. In addition, parasites such as ticks and fleas may enter homes, presenting additional health dangers. Competent animal removal not only manages current infestations but prevents reoccurrences, thus protecting public health. Professionals experienced in ethical removal confirm that animals are relocated instead of injured, encouraging equilibrium between animal life and human habitats. Ultimately, services serve a vital function in preserving community well-being as well as nature's balance.

Harm Prevention for Your Possessions

The provision of effective wildlife removal solutions is crucial in defending properties against major damage. Wildlife encroachment causes structural harm, such as bitten electrical wires, damaged insulation, and weakened roofing. Additionally, burrowing animals endanger foundations, which can lead to costly repairs. Addressing infestations promptly prevents further deterioration and maintains property value. Professional wildlife removal includes sealing entry points, reducing the likelihood of future invasions. This preventative approach safeguards the building’s physical integrity and limits disturbances to daily life. Investing in thorough wildlife removal mitigates risks, ensuring a secure and damage-free space for homeowners and business owners alike.

Inspection and Evaluation Process

A detailed inspection and assessment procedure is vital in wildlife removal, as it allows specialists to identify the particular challenges posed by nuisance animals. Specialists begin by examining the property for evidence of wildlife activity, such as droppings, tracks, and nesting materials. They evaluate potential entry points, including gaps in walls, roofs, and foundations that animals might enter through. Additionally, the evaluation includes checking for damage caused by wildlife, which can show the extent of the infestation. Understanding the behavioral patterns and habits of the animals involved is crucial for effective management. This detailed assessment not only influences the removal strategy but also aids in preventing future invasions, ensuring a long-term solution for a pest-free environment.

Protected Taking Out Procedures

Using kind and effective methods, wildlife removal experts apply a range of harmless techniques to handle infestations. These experts prioritize the well-being of both animals and the environment. Trapping is a widely used method, using custom cages that trap wildlife without harm, allowing for relocation to appropriate habitats. Also, exclusion methods seal entry points, stopping future intrusions. Experts may additionally use natural repellents that keep away wildlife without causing distress. Monitoring and follow-up assessments confirm the effectiveness of these strategies, allowing for adjustments when needed. By focusing on humane practices, wildlife removal specialists promote a balanced coexistence between humans and local wildlife, fostering a pest-free environment while respecting nature’s ecosystem role.

Averting Future Wildlife Intrusions

Comprehending the importance of humane wildlife removal naturally leads to the consideration of prevention strategies against subsequent pest invasions. Effective prevention begins with locating and closing entry points around residences and structures. This encompasses examining roofs, attics, basements, and foundations for openings or fissures that wildlife can exploit.

Additionally, eliminating nutritional sources is critical. Lock garbage bins, compost piles, and pet food to prevent animals from seeking easy meals. Maintaining a neat yard by cutting back overgrown vegetation and removing debris decreases potential habitats for wildlife.

Setting up noise deterrents or motion-activated lights can further discourage unwanted visitors. Ongoing inspection of the location for signs of wildlife activity helps property owners to manage concerns before they amplify. Through taking these proactive steps, individuals can create an environment that reduces the risk of future wildlife infestations, promoting a tranquil relationship with nature while upholding a animal-free home.

Things to Think about When Selecting a Animal Extraction Service?

When seeking out a wildlife removal service, what important considerations should homeowners consider? First, it is essential to evaluate the company's knowledge and skills in handling particular animal problems. A trustworthy company should have qualified professionals familiar with local regulations and ethical removal methods. Furthermore, homeowners should inquire about the techniques used for extraction and prevention, making sure they emphasize safety and environmental responsibility.

Additionally, confirming licensing and insurance can protect homeowners from legal responsibility during the removal process. Customer feedback and testimonials provide insight into the company's standing and effectiveness. In conclusion, clarity about costs and guarantees is vital; a reputable company will provide transparent quotes and follow-up support. By concentrating on these elements, homeowners can choose a animal control provider that meets their needs, ensuring a pest-free environment while adhering to moral principles.

Which Types of Creatures Do Pest Control Companies Deal With?

Professional wildlife removal commonly tackle various animals, like raccoons, squirrels, opossums, bats, and birds. They manage problems arising from infestations, ensuring safe extraction and mitigation of recurrent wildlife interaction in residential and commercial properties.

Is Wildlife Removal Service Ecologically Friendly?

Animal removal services can be eco-friendly, implementing ethical practices to transport wildlife without harm. Many stress eco-conscious methods, maintaining minimal disruption to local ecosystems while properly handling wildlife-related issues for homeowners and businesses alike.

How Long Does the Removal Process Typically Take?

The process of removal generally lasts a few hours up to a couple of days, based on the intricacy of the situation and the species involved. Elements like location and required follow-up measures may also affect the duration.

Might Animal Control Injure My Premises?

Wildlife removal can potentially cause some property damage, based on the technique employed and the circumstances. However, expert providers work to reduce any damage and often offer restoration as part of the service.

What Should I Do if I Observe Wildlife Repeatedly?

If creatures is spotted again, persons should maintain a safe distance, avoid direct interactions, and document the sighting. Reporting the incident to local wildlife authorities can assure proper handling and management of the situation.
